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04071787906 04149 57967 6585911
9122696132 3666887687 0144910
9122696132 3666887687 0144910
03916 686703 81166864 69
All about undefined
Interested in learning more?
9122696132 3666887687 0144910
03916 686703 81166864 69
See more
77 6385318529
98739364973 042622 7811019 877312
See more
74388273249 21562546
336361 0656343966 26673
See more